## C. Multi-Year Orders
   *   **Front-Loaded Revenue Recognition:** Multi-year contracts, such as the **₹72 Cr DRDO order**, recognize bulk revenue within **90 days of execution**, with AMC revenue amortized over the contract life.
   *   **Bundled AMC Structure:** AMC components cover both software and services, are negotiated per contract, and may commence after free periods (90 days to one year), creating recurring revenue tailwinds.

## B. Power Solutions
   *   **Core Focus:** Delivers **custom-built power system solutions** via engineering consultancy for electrical utilities, covering transmission, distribution, and integration of distributed energy resources.  
   *   **Market Differentiation:** Positioned as **India’s #1 software provider for power distribution**, distinct from ETAP (transmission-focused), enhancing competitive moat.  
   *   **Expansion Momentum:** Plans to convert **2 additional states into orders** in H2, supporting geographic diversification and smoother revenue recognition.  
   *   **Service Integration Strategy:** Expanding service portfolio alongside products to deepen client engagement and drive **broader market penetration**.

## D. Semiconductor
   *   **End-to-End Design Capability:** Offers full-cycle **ASIC, FPGA, and SOC design** with DO-254 compliance for space/defense, targeting low-power, high-performance applications.  
   *   **Strategic Verticalization:** Launched **TechLabs Semiconductor** as a dedicated subsidiary and formed **integrated design-manufacturing partnership with Kaynes Semicon** (pre- to post-silicon).  
   *   **Recurring Revenue Model:** Focuses on **long-term client expansion**—starting with one project and scaling across teams and projects for predictable income.  
   *   **International Growth Catalyst:** Acquisition of a **US-customer-focused firm with offshore centers** expected to accelerate global footprint, especially in semicon division.

## A. Proprietary Software
   *   **Core Differentiation:** Competitive advantage stems from a **proprietary technical library** built over 25 years—not third-party tools—enabling integrated, end-to-end power system solutions.
   *   **Platform & Access:** Offers **multi-platform accessibility**, including mobile devices, ensuring 24/7 client access to mission-critical resources.
   *   **Specialized Capabilities:** Software uniquely models **large-scale distribution networks** (e.g., 100,000+ transformers), outperforming transmission-focused tools like ETAP.
   *   **Integrated Service Model:** SOC setup and predictive analytics are powered by proprietary software, reinforcing a **consolidated pricing model** justified by technical depth.

## A. Order Approval Delays
   *   **Structural Demand Drivers:** Rising stress on power infrastructure, government modernization programs, and Make in India are fueling demand for specialized engineering and simulation services.
   *   **Pipeline Intact, Execution Timing Shifted:** All communicated opportunities remain active; delays stem from **larger order sizes** requiring extended internal approval timelines, not lost business.
   *   **Process Adaptation Underway:** Company has adjusted to complex multi-level sign-off requirements for **large orders (5–6 approval layers)**, improving internal readiness despite slower fulfillment cycles.
